The Yuma tribe lived in the southwestern United States, primarily along the Colorado River in present-day Arizona and California. The climate in this region is characterized by hot summers, mild winters, and low annual rainfall, making it a desert environment. The availability of water from the Colorado River was crucial for their agriculture and sustenance, enabling them to cultivate crops like corn, beans, and squash. The climate also influenced their lifestyle, with the tribe adapting to the harsh conditions by developing irrigation techniques and seasonal migration patterns.
